Boring game despite the attractive setting and premise. Both dialogues and exploration are incredibly slow, with little to no input from the player. There is an interesting section where you are asked to stay still despite weird stuff happening around you. It only happens once during the whole game, but I thought that could have been used a few more times to spice things up. It seems that you can get different endings depending on your choices, but it never felt like my actions mattered. You just follow people around and answer questions. The controls are so wonky that even picking up objects or walking down a hallway can become frustrating. It was a nightmare with the motion controllers. The voice input was an excellent idea though, I just found out I am a terrible actor!!
